US OptionsDetailed Quotes

XBI241108P97500

Watchlist
  • 0.80
  • -0.03-3.61%
15min DelayClose Nov 5 16:00 ET
1.39High0.80Low

SPDR S&P Biotech ETF Newsroom

No Data